HC Deb 11 January 2001 vol 360 c610W
Mr. Baker

To ask the Secretary of State for Social Security how much money has been provided from the Social Fund to individuals as a result of the recent flooding(a) nationally and (b) in Lewes. [144708]

Angela Eagle

At 5 January 2001 total payments made nationally from the 2000–01 discretionary Social Fund budget in respect of flooding were £157,684 in community care grant payments and £11,635 in crisis loan payments.

Payments made by the Benefits Agency Central Sussex district, which covers Lewes, amount to £4,636 for community care grants and £970 for crisis loans.
